IdJELE: Indonesian Journal of Education, Learning, and Evaluation is a peer–reviewed scholarly journal that publishes high–quality research articles, conceptual analyses, literature reviews, and reports on best practices in the field of education. The journal is dedicated to advancing scholarly discourse and contributing to the body of knowledge, theory development, and evidence–based practices in education, with a particular emphasis on learning processes and educational evaluation.
Published biannually (May and November), IdJELE serves as an open–access platform for the dissemination of academic work by scholars, researchers, education professionals, and postgraduate students from Indonesia and around the world.
The journal seeks to:
-
Facilitate the exchange of innovative ideas, research findings, and theoretical advancements in the educational sciences.
-
Bridge the nexus between educational theory, pedagogical practice, and policy development.
-
Serve as a reputable and reliable reference for research in education, learning, and evaluation.
